(usa) Senior, Software Engineer - Data Engineer

Walmart Walmart · Retail · Bentonville, AR

Senior Software Engineer focused on designing, developing, and maintaining scalable software solutions, including data engineering aspects for space planning and assortment within Walmart's Fusion-Microspace team. The role involves analyzing requirements, coding, testing, troubleshooting, and implementing DevOps practices, with a focus on Python, SQL, API integration, and cloud platforms like Azure.

What you'd actually do

  1. Analyze and classify business and technical requirements, ensuring alignment with project objectives and risk mitigation.
  2. Design scalable software solutions, converting high-level designs into detailed functional components.
  3. Develop, configure, and maintain clean, testable code adhering to coding standards and security policies.
  4. Build automation scripts to streamline continuous integration and delivery processes.
  5. Execute and support comprehensive testing strategies to identify and resolve defects.

Skills

Required

  • Python
  • SQL
  • API integration
  • Agile software development methodologies
  • DevOps practices
  • designing scalable, distributed systems
  • debugging
  • integration testing
  • defect management
  • Microsoft Azure
  • Azure Data Factory
  • Azure Databricks

Nice to have

  • Master’s degree in Computer Science, Computer Engineering, Computer Information Systems, Software Engineering, or related area and 1 year's experience in software engineering or related area.
  • creating inclusive digital experiences
  • implementing Web Content Accessibility Guidelines (WCAG) 2.2 AA standards
  • assistive technologies
  • integrating digital accessibility seamlessly